Mangalore International Airport Bags Three Gold Award at Quality Concepts Convention in Bengaluru
Mangalore International Airport (MIA) haswon three gold awards on September 10 at Quality Circle Forum Of India (QCFI) organized the daylong event at T John Institute of Technology, Bannerghatta, Bengaluru under the theme “Nurture Quality Concepts for a Better Future”. With this, MIA showcased its prowess in quality and allied areas at the 32nd chapter convention on Quality Concepts 2023 for Performance Excellence. More than 490 teams participated in the event.
Mangalore International Airport entered three teams for the event – Team Emerge, Team Prime and Team Swift. While Team Emerge from environment, engineering, and maintenance (E&M) and quality presented a project on ‘5S’ Implementation, Team Prime from non-aero showcased ‘Box In Box’ concept, and Team Swift comprising staff from terminal and quality came up with project Quick Response (QR). The jury selected these three projects under gold category.
